UCLA Health is seeking an Accounts Receivable (A/R) Support
Analyst to support our collections efforts and ensure efficient account
resolution. Reporting to the Assistant Director of Collections, you will
analyze A/R data, monitor vendor performance, and provide insights that drive
financial and operational improvements. This role requires strong analytical
skills, collaboration across departments, and a solid understanding of the revenue
cycle.
In this role, you will:
- Analyze
A/R data using tools like Tableau and Excel to generate reports,
dashboards, and aging summaries. - Identify
reimbursement trends, delays, and process inefficiencies; recommend
improvements based on audit findings. - Review
vendor reports, validate invoicing, and support workflow enhancements for
increased recovery and efficiency. - Collaborate
with stakeholders to define reporting needs, improve analytic
capabilities, and support training initiatives. - Escalate
issues related to charge capture, vendor compliance, and data
discrepancies to appropriate teams. - Stay
current on regulations and department policies; draft updates and support
compliance initiatives.
